Insalada (en. Salad)
in-sah-lah-dah
Meaning & Definition
EnglishTagalog
noun
A fragrant dish usually made of fresh vegetables.
The salad with lettuce, tomatoes, and onions is delicious.
Masarap ang insalada na may lettuce, kamatis, at sibuyas.
A dish usually served as a side dish or accompaniment.
It is easy to prepare salad as a side dish for dinner.
Madaling ihanda ang insalada bilang pang-ulam sa hapunan.
Etymology
Spanish
